Best Outdoor Wedding Planning Tips for Grand Rapids Couples




Preparing for an outdoor wedding can be a magical and memorable experience, but it comes with its own set of unique challenges. Check out these outdoor wedding planning tips to ensure your special day goes off without a hitch.

Choose the Right Location

Consider a location that holds sentimental value or offers stunning natural backdrops. Ensure the venue has adequate space for your guests and essential amenities like restrooms and parking. 

Have a Weather Plan

Rent a tent or marquee to protect against rain or intense sun. Provide guests with items like umbrellas, fans, or blankets depending on the season.

Plan for Comfort

Consider your guests' comfort throughout the event. That may include plenty of seating options and shade, hydration stations with water or portable heaters or fire pits to keep guests warm.

Make Catering Easy

Hire a caterer experienced with outdoor events. Food stations or buffets can make service smoother and more efficient.

Add Personal Touches

Incorporate elements that reflect your personalities and love story. Whether it’s a custom cocktail, a photo booth, or a unique guest book, these details will make your wedding memorable for you and your guests.
